May gives backing to new Top Gear

-

James May has given his seal of approvalto the new Top Gear.

The latest series of the BBC motoring show – fronted by Matt LeBlanc, Chris Harri sand Rory Reid after Chris Evans bowed out–ended in April.

May, 54, said he had “tried to be quite philosophi­cal about” the end of his run on the programme with Jeremy Clarkson and Richard Hammond.

He told BBC Breakfast the new Top Gear team were “doing an increasing­ly good job of it”.
